If you want to sell information products you should create your own membership site instead of using some platform like Udemy.com.

Here’s why.

I’ve used Udemy in the past and there’s too many restrictions. For example, your videos need to have a certain length. You can’t have videos longer than 20 minutes. But what if I want to do a one hour, in-depth walkthrough of one of my campaigns? Udemy won’t let me.

Also they control the pricing of your courses. You can’t sell courses that are more expensive than $50 if you want your course listed.

But what if my product is worth $2,000 or even more?

Udemy won’t let me sell the course at it’s value.

Furthermore, I once uploaded an entire course on music marketing to Udemy and the quality was really good. However, Udemy reached out to me and said there was a slight white noise in the background. So they forced me to re-record my entire course in order to publish it.

That’s actually the moment I decided to leave Udemy for good.
